單模光纖的三維模場(chǎng)分布_第1頁(yè)
單模光纖的三維模場(chǎng)分布_第2頁(yè)
單模光纖的三維模場(chǎng)分布_第3頁(yè)
單模光纖的三維模場(chǎng)分布_第4頁(yè)
單模光纖的三維模場(chǎng)分布_第5頁(yè)
已閱讀5頁(yè),還剩16頁(yè)未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

1、單模光纖的三維模場(chǎng)分布目 錄 TOC o 1-5 h z HYPERLINK l bookmark2 o Current Document 1單模光纖1 HYPERLINK l bookmark4 o Current Document 2單模光纖模場(chǎng)分布近似13 MATLABS 言63、1主程序63、2調(diào)用函數(shù)93、3程序運(yùn)行說(shuō)明 114總結(jié)16單模光纖的三維模場(chǎng)分布1單模光纖在工作波長(zhǎng)中,只能傳輸一個(gè)傳播模式的光纖,通常簡(jiǎn)稱為單模光纖 (SMF:SingleModeFiber)。由于光纖的纖芯很細(xì)(約10pm)而且折射率呈階躍狀分布,當(dāng)歸一化頻率V參數(shù) =式中,A、B待定常數(shù),Jm :m 階

2、第一類(lèi)貝塞爾函數(shù),Km:m階第二類(lèi)變形貝塞爾函數(shù)U=kca VWkau表示導(dǎo)波模場(chǎng)在纖芯內(nèi)部的橫向分布規(guī)律,w表示它在包層中的橫向分布規(guī)律,兩者結(jié) 合起來(lái),就可以完整地描述導(dǎo)波模的橫向分布規(guī)律 ;B就是軸向的相位傳播常數(shù),表明導(dǎo)波 模的縱向傳輸特性。單模光纖的三維模場(chǎng)分布與電磁學(xué)公式比較 比* = / _/=如20gl 伊 kM 82 hl = p2幾個(gè)低階第一類(lèi)貝塞爾函數(shù)曲線 用縱向分量表示的其她分量幾個(gè)低階第二類(lèi)變形貝塞爾函數(shù)曲線必信廣聞川知-停)1 1E陽(yáng)=小1粘心).1上(力1M利用邊界條件得到特征方程旬除簡(jiǎn)化的特征方程,對(duì)于實(shí)際在rui_(亞) 一4,UJrn( 6 )+ WKm (

3、 W) - u2 2單模光纖的三維模場(chǎng)分布上面這些公式與電磁場(chǎng)與電磁波中公式完全相同,求解很困難,一般用數(shù)值法,如果只求各種模 式的截止條件,只需令W2 = 0,求解滿足邊界條件的U,則相對(duì)簡(jiǎn)單一些、 J (u)Kv(w), 2 Jv(u), 2 Kv(w)2 TOC o 1-5 h z HYPERLINK l bookmark14 o Current Document 2 211u2 w2uJv(u) wKv(w)1 uJv(u)2 wKv(w)u、w與B之間相互關(guān)系的方程,對(duì)于弱導(dǎo)光纖(n1F2)本征方程就是反映導(dǎo)波模涉及到的參數(shù) 則可得到本征方程 HYPERLINK l bookmark

4、16 o Current Document Jv (u) Kv (w)111/、 v 22uJ v (u) wK v (w) u w,可以在此條件下求解纖芯內(nèi)的歸一化TMn、EHU Hen.在電磁波課程中我們已當(dāng)W=0,對(duì)應(yīng)包層中導(dǎo)波模與輻射模的轉(zhuǎn)折點(diǎn)或臨界點(diǎn)丁瓦THq。模的截止波長(zhǎng)EHm模的截止波長(zhǎng)HEg模的截止波長(zhǎng),m 2HEe模的截止波長(zhǎng),m = 1相位常數(shù)U。導(dǎo)波模一共可以分成4種模式即,TE0 經(jīng)得到了這些模的截止波長(zhǎng),下面直接寫(xiě)出結(jié)果。況0抬4(EH1m)二餐(#-裙);4(he皿)=匹5;一斑我吁2兒(HEG =次畫(huà)-MR上面這些式子中,uxy表示x階貝塞爾函數(shù)的第y個(gè)零點(diǎn),下面

5、表5、1就是幾個(gè)低階貝塞爾函 數(shù)的零點(diǎn)位置。HE11模對(duì)應(yīng)0階貝塞爾函數(shù)的第零個(gè)零點(diǎn)JmU的第n個(gè)根umnnm012312、 404833、 831715、135626、 38016單模光纖的三維模場(chǎng)分布25、 520087、 015598、417249、 7610238、 6537310、 1734711、 6198413、 01520411、 7915312、 3236914、 7959616、 22347514、 93049216、6317、 9598214、 40942定義另一個(gè)重要的特征參量,V,稱為光纖的歸一化頻率,就是一個(gè)無(wú)量綱的參數(shù) 二 A()q (九;一鹿|72當(dāng)W2 = 0

6、時(shí),相應(yīng)的U記為2n2Uc,V記為Vc, Vc稱之為歸一化截止頻率。顯然,此時(shí)Uc = Vc且:Vc2 a 2(nic1)2這樣,光纖中任意一個(gè)模式的傳播條件就是2 a 22 2V Vc (nin2)2c光纖中單模傳播的條件就是:0 V 2.4053 MATLAlBgg3、1主程序1、運(yùn)行框位置大小抬頭默認(rèn)文本繪圖相框位置背景顏色運(yùn)行框位置大小框gcc=figure( Position ,10,50,1100,660);設(shè)置程序抬頭set(gcc, Menubar , none , Name,單模光釬的三21模場(chǎng)分布 ,NumberTitle , off );單模光纖的三維模場(chǎng)分布uicont

7、rol(gcc, 6, StringStyle , text , Units , normalized,單模光釬的三21模場(chǎng)分布,F(xiàn)ontsize,24, PositionHorizontal,0 、01,0、35,0、 , center , Back05,0,050 8 09);設(shè)置交互區(qū)域框uicontrol(gcc, 24, Back 設(shè)置繪圖框Style ,1,1,1);,Frame,Units , normalized,Position,0、15,0 、015,0、8,0、b=axes( Position設(shè)置程序背景顏色,0、15,0 、3,0、8,0、68);set(gcc, co

8、lor2、視圖縮放功能,0、9);通過(guò)改變坐標(biāo)軸的值改變視圖大小uicontrol(gcc,Style , text , Units , normalized, Fontsize,15,Position,004,0、21,0、075,0 、04,、String ,同比例縮放,Fontsize,12, HorizontalCOM= j=get(hdxyz,Value); ,-f,f,zlim,0,g);,f=5*j;,g=1*j;, left , Back, set(b,xlim,-f,f,ylim,1 1 04);I!hdxyz=uicontrol(gcc,Style18,0、12,0、04,

9、Min ,0,uicontrol(gcc,Max ,2, StyleValue;, text, slider,1, Call, Units, Units , normalized,COM);, normalized, Fontsize, Position,15,0Position、015,0 、,0043,013,0String07,004,z 方向縮放,F(xiàn)ontsizeCOM0= l=get(hdz,Value);,12, Horizontal , set(b,zlim,0,l);, left , Back;,1 1 04);hdz=uicontrol(gcc,12,004,Style, s

10、lider, Units , normalized, Position,0015,01,0Min ,0, Max ,2, Value,1, Call,COM0);uicontrol(gcc,Style , text , Units, normalized, Fontsize,15,Position,004,005,0075,004,String , xy 方向縮放,FontsizeCOM1= k=get(hdxy,Value);,12, Horizontal, left,Back,1 1 0,set(b,xlim,-k,k,ylim,-k,k);4);hdxy=uicontrol(gcc,02

11、,0、12,0、04,Style, slider,Units , normalized, Position,0015,0Min ,2, Max ,10, Value3、加設(shè)菜單更改圖像背景顏色,5, Call ,COM1);截圖運(yùn)行程序 建立程序使用說(shuō)明hview=uimenu(hsz,Label,轉(zhuǎn)換視角,Separator, on);uimenu(hview,Label,側(cè)視圖, Accelerator, z,Call,view(90,0);uimenu(hview,Label,俯視圖, Accelerator, x,Call,view(0,90);uimenu(hview,Label,原

12、視圖, Accelerator, c,Call, view(-37、5,30)設(shè)置);hsz=uimenu(gcc,Label);建立旋轉(zhuǎn)動(dòng)畫(huà)COM= for el=-10:1:150 on; , end ;view(-375,el);, grid off;, drawnow; , gridhxz=uimenu(hview,Label,旋轉(zhuǎn)動(dòng)畫(huà),Accelerator,v, Call ,COM);建立更改繪圖圖像的背景顏色菜單單模光纖的三維模場(chǎng)分布uimenu(htbjs,Label,草綠色,Call , set(gca,Color,07 09 04)uimenu(hzbc,Label,天青色

13、,Call , set(gca,Color,0、5 0、8 0、9)uimenu(hzbc,Label,橙紅色,Call , set(gca,Color,09 04 03)uimenu(hzbc,Label,取消顏色,Call , set(gca,Color,1 1 1);建立截圖菜單COM1= saveas(gcc,Mypictures,jpg);hSPC=uimenu(gcc,Label,文件);uimenu(hSPC,Label ,運(yùn)行程序截圖,Call ,COM1);uimenu(hSPC,Label ,打開(kāi)程序路徑,Call , winopen(pwd););uimenu(hSPC,

14、Label ,打開(kāi)程序截圖,Call , b=strcat(pwd,Mypic、,圖像背景顏色,Separatorhtbjs=uimenu(hsz,Label,on););jpg);,winopen(b);););建立程序使用說(shuō)明菜單COM2=hhelp=uimenu(gcc,單模光纖的三維模場(chǎng)分布、Label,幫助);doc);,winopen(a);uimenu(hhelp, Label4、滑動(dòng)條滑動(dòng)條主程序,程序使用說(shuō)明,Call,COM2);hsli1=uicontrol(gcc, 14,0、4,0、04, 6453, CallBackMinStyle , slider,0、1, Ma

15、x ,2、, Units , normalized1845, Value ,1、,Position,0 、2,0、,set(azmcur,String,num2str(get(hsli1,Value);set(gcc,Position,10,50,1100,660);標(biāo)記滑動(dòng)條最小值 azmmin=uicontrol(gcc,Style, text);, Units , normalized, Fontsize,12, Position,0 、155,0 、14,0、標(biāo)記滑動(dòng)條最大值azmmax=uicontrol(gcc,045,004,String,num2str(get(hsli1,Mi

16、n),Back ,1,1,1);Style, text, Units , normalized, Fontsize,12, Position,0 、61,0、14,0、045,0 、04, 設(shè)置輸出值位置String,num2str(get(hsli1,Max),Back ,1,1,1);uicontrol(gcc, Style , text04, String , U =, Fontsize滑動(dòng)條返回值azmcur=uicontrol(gcc,Style, Units , normalized , Position ,025,02,004,0,15, Horizontal , left ,

17、Back ,1,1,1);,text , Units , normalized , Fontsize ,15, Position,0 、29,0、2,0、06,0、04, String ,num2str(get(hsli1,Value ), Back ,0 、9,0、8,0、9);觸發(fā)函數(shù)COM3= n=str2num(get(azmcur,String);, set(UW,String,num2str(dataUW(n) ); ;設(shè)置文本區(qū)域UW=uicontrol(gcc,Style , Text, Units , normalized, String7473, Fontsize函數(shù)觸發(fā)按

18、鈕,15, Position,048,02,007,004, Backuicontrol(gcc,04, String,Style , Push , 對(duì)應(yīng)加,fontSizeUnits , normalized,10, Call ,COM3);, Position,1,09 08 09);,0 、38,0 、2,0、07,0單模光纖的三維模場(chǎng)分布第二個(gè)滑動(dòng)條程序雷同此處不作贅述5 、計(jì)算歸一化函數(shù)值觸發(fā)函數(shù)COM5= aa=str2num(get(azmcur,String);, bb=str2num(get(elvcur,String);,set(scz,String,num2str(cc(

19、aa,bb);設(shè)置輸出文本區(qū)域scz=uicontrol(gcc,Style , Text , Units , normalized , String ,2、405, Position ,0、81,0、17,0、12,0、05, Horizontal , center , Fontsize ,15, Back ,0、9 0、8 0、9);函數(shù)觸發(fā)按鈕 uicontrol(gcc,Style , Push , Units , normalized, Posi ,067,017,0、12,0、05, String,計(jì)算歸一化頻率 V , fontSize,10, Call6、繪圖按鈕關(guān)閉按鈕,CO

20、M5);uicontrol(gcc,Style , push , Units , normalized, Fontsize67,0、04,0 、12,0 、1, String,繪圖,Call , COMM(hsli1,hsli2),18, Position );,0uicontrol(gcc,Style , push , Units , normalized, Fontsize0、765,0 、045,0 、08,0、08, String,動(dòng)畫(huà),Call ,COM);,18, Position,uicontrol(gcc,Style , push , Units , normalized, F

21、ontsize81,0、04,0、12,0、1, String,關(guān)閉,Call , close all);,18, Position,03、2調(diào)用函數(shù)(1) COMM繪圖函數(shù)function COMM(hsli1,hsli2)如果歸一化頻率大于2、4048程序?qū)?huì)報(bào)錯(cuò)并不會(huì)執(zhí)行繪圖指令U=get(hsli1, Value );W=get(hsli2, Value );M=sqrt(U 、A2+W A2);if M2、4048msgbox(歸一化頻率大于2、4048,請(qǐng)更換計(jì)算公式!,提示!)如果歸一化頻率小于等于 2、408程序?qū)?huì)運(yùn)行繪圖指令elseN=201;R1=linspace(0,1

22、,N);R2=linspace(1,5,N);Theta1=linspace(0,2*pi,N);Theta2=linspace(0,2*pi,N);E1=zeros(N,N);E2=zeros(N,N);I1=E1;I2=E2;for i = 1:NE1(:,i)=besselj(0,U*R1);I1(:,i)=E1(:,i)、A2;endfor i = 1:NE2(:,i)=besselj(0,U)、*besselk(0,W 、*R2) 、/besselk(0,W);單模光纖的三維模場(chǎng)分布I2(:,i)=E2(:,i)、A2;end Thetal, R1=meshgrid(Theta1,R

23、1); Theta2, R2=meshgrid(Theta2,R2); X1, Y1=pol2cart(Theta1,R1); X2, Y2=pol2cart(Theta2,R2); mesh(X1,Y1,I1); hold on mesh(X2,Y2,I2); colorbar xlabel(x)ylabel(y)zlabel(z)pause(1) hold off end cc 計(jì)算歸一化頻率,若大于2、4048程序?qū)?huì)報(bào)錯(cuò)程序計(jì)算完后將會(huì)返回V直function V=cc(aa,bb) V1=sqrt(aa 、A2+bb、a2); if V12、4048msgbox(請(qǐng)確認(rèn)歸一化頻率0V2、408, 提示!);endV=sqrt(aa A2+bb A2);(3)function W=data_UW(n)用于對(duì)輸入的 匿詢對(duì)應(yīng)的w值 并將其返回到原函數(shù)function W=data_UW(n)U2=因數(shù)據(jù)過(guò)于龐大故略;W2=因數(shù)據(jù)過(guò)于龐大故略;%U W以100行1列存儲(chǔ) j=0;for i=1:980if U2(i)-n0、001 % 將U2中的數(shù)據(jù)依次與傳

溫馨提示

  • 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

評(píng)論

0/150

提交評(píng)論